I'm always adjusting and trying to improve. Some weeks are better then others, but I finally have gotten to the point where when I lose I can pin point where in the hand I lose. The actions I took that cause me to lose, and the improvements needed to be made for it not to happen again. This alone has helped with tilt figuring I can figure out where I went wrong, along with accepting when I played the hand right, and just fell into a cooler....

This is a consept that I believe to be the most important step to overcoming the frustrations of beats.

When I started taking poker seriously and started playing online I was completely optimistic and enthusiastic. I think I was an average player at first using bankroll management and reading any and everything I could get a hold of which I used to build a bankroll at various sites. Since April 15, 2011 I've been the total opposite. In the U.S. it's been a discouraging reality for online play. I've been screwed out of a $300 cashout from a site that doesn't exist anymore (Lock Poker) as well as a few 'e-wallets' that were seized/shut down w/$ on them, somewhere in the neighborhood of $120 or so. I now play mostly at intertops since that's where most of my $ is but I do enjoy playing at other sites that I'm allowed to play at. I play mostly freerolls at these other sites but that seems to be mostly for fun. I love this game. I like playing w/my wife and a friend or two but live games around me are becoming scarce and hard to find so I'm almost exclusively limited to online games. I believe my skill has enhanced and been tested by some great online players, but making a substantial deposit ($100 or more) is off the table, for now. Maybe I just need to move to canada, lol. :p
